Russia uses foreign women for caustic chemical work on Shahed drones
Great report from @EJ_Burrows @lhinnant
. Russia uses foreign women to work w/chemicals so caustic their faces blister while building Shahed drones. Yet Russian women are prohibited from working with these chemicals out of fear of birth defects or harming fertility/1 -

World Bank vote, EU agree €35B Ukraine loan from frozen Russian assets
The World Bank vote came a day after European Union officials agreed to provide Ukraine with up to 35 billion euros as part of a planned loan from the G7 countries, backed by income from frozen Russian Central Bank assets.

World Bank to manage $50 billion Ukraine fund, Russia objects.
The fund will be managed by the World Bank. It should help fulfill the G7's promise to provide Ukraine with up to $50 billion in additional funding by the end of the year. The only objection to the vote came from Russia.
